Felipe Pedraza, a freshman Agricultural Education major from Screven County, has a passion for agriculture. 
   Since April 2008, he has served as a State FFA Vice-President for the Georgia FFA Association.  
   Throughout his year of service, Pedraza has represented over 28,000 FFA members in the State of Georgia.  Some of his responsibilities include serving as a delegate at the National FFA Convention, hosting several in-state conferences for FFA members to learn about leadership and FFA, and providing key assistance at the State FFA Convention.
